JAMMU — Authorities in Jammu and Kashmir’s Doda district have imposed restrictions on trekking, hiking, camping and other adventure activities across Bhaderwah subdivision, citing security concerns and potential natural hazards. Additional Deputy Commissioner, Bhadarwah, Sunil Kumar Bhityal issued the order under Section 163 of the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ita (BNSS), an official said on Wednesday. […]

Former DDC Chairperson Baramulla Safina Baig joins National Conference
SRINAGAR — Former chairperson of the District Development Council (DDC) Baramulla, Safina Baig, on Wednesday joined the ruling National Conference here. Safina Baig is the wife of former deputy chief minister, and PDP co-founder Muzaffar Hussain Baig. She joined the National Conference (NC) in the presence of party president Farooq Abdullah, and Chief Minister Omar […]

Fresh batch of 9,837 pilgrims leave for Amarnath Yatra in Kashmir
JAMMU — A fresh batch of 9,837 pilgrims left the Bhagwati Nagar base camp here for the annual Amarnath Yatra in Kashmir, amid tight security on Wednesday, officials said. They said this is the largest batch of pilgrims so far this year, comprising 7,004 men, 2,810 women, 21 children and two transgender persons. While 4,480 […]
